Institutions of learning have been asked to embrace and encourage the teaching of Vocational education in the new Curriculum that is to provide hands on skills to students.
This message was made by Eng. Kenneth Kaijuka and officials from the ministry of education and sports at the 9th graduation of Nakawa Vocational Training College
547 graduands enrolled in different doctrines at Nakawa Vocational training College's 9th graduation.
The ceremony started with a procession before the chief guest Eng. Kaijuka inspected the different work activities in the hands on practical tasks exhibited by the institution's continuing students.
Fred Muwanga, the institution's principal implored government's efforts in revising the policy on Tvet that will see a competitive workforce

Uganda has had a setback in her world cup qualifier campaign after the cricket cranes lost to Namibia by 6 wickets in their second tournament game played this evening at the wanderers cricket grounds in Windhoek, Namibia.

The under -13 Warrior Stars and under -17 Pine club emerged winners at a Rotary football tournament organized by Rotary and Rotaract Clubs of Kitante.
The event held at Kamokya Mulimira Zone was to bring young people together and educate them about responsible citizenship.

Kalangala district comprises of 84 habitable islands, including the largest, Buggala Island which is home to numerous government infrastructures.
Despite concerted efforts by the government and private developers to establish educational facilities in the area, parents still grapple with the daunting task of providing their children access to schooling.
